If an LV contains a partition table, then libparted will see the
partitions but device nodes won't be created for them, which broke the
reuse and replace automatically_partition scripts. Tolerate this
situation by ignoring device nodes that don't exist, or for which
blockdev breaks in other ways (LP: #770041). - 89. By Colin Watson

Fix reuse and replace options to umount using the path name
instead of the device name to work around a bug where ntfs-3g
on dmraid can not be unmounted with the device name, which
then caused the installer to hang (LP: #725408).
